Vick Ballard received 21 touches in Week 7 against the Browns, finishing with 103 total yards on the afternoon. The rookie running back broke off a 26-yard run late in the game while helping run out clock.

Phillip Wilson of the Indianapolis Star believes Ballard has proven he deserves more work even when Donald Brown returns from injury.
Fantasy Impact: The Colts leaned on the ground game more on Sunday, with Ballard leading the way. Delone Carter also received 11 carries, but Ballard was clearly the No. 1 back this time around.
Brown may not return this week as he has yet to practice, so Ballard could be in for another solid day against a Titans defense that’s allowing 141.7 yards rushing per game. Be sure to check on the status of the Colts backfield throughout the week, and consider adding Ballard if you can.
